R E S O L U T I O N
|
|
|
WHEREAS, Carlos Aguayo of McAllen has rendered outstanding |
|
service to his fellow Texans during the 84th Legislature as one of |
|
the inaugural participants in the Rio Grande Valley Legislative |
|
Internship Program; and |
|
WHEREAS, Sponsored by State Representative Terry Canales and |
|
The University of Texas--Pan American Foundation, this program is |
|
designed to encourage UTPA students to pursue careers in public |
|
service; Mr. Aguayo has worked in the Capitol office of State |
|
Representative Oscar Longoria, where he has handled a range of |
|
important responsibilities over the course of the legislative |
|
session; and |
|
WHEREAS, Carlos Aguayo is a cum laude graduate of UTPA, where |
|
he earned a bachelor's degree in economics with a minor in political |
|
science in December 2014; during his academic career, he attended |
|
the summerlong UTPA Law School Preparation Institute and was |
|
awarded first place nationally in the Up to Us Competition, a |
|
program sponsored by the Clinton Global Initiative; active in a |
|
number of campus organizations as well, he served as secretary of |
|
the Economics Society and historian of the Financial Management |
|
Association, and he found time to volunteer as an organizer for the |
|
Border Economic Development and Entrepreneurship Symposium in 2013 |
|
and 2014; and |
|
WHEREAS, This notable young Texan has performed his duties as |
|
a legislative intern with skill and dedication, and he has gained |
|
valuable leadership experience while learning more about the issues |
|
confronting citizens of the Lone Star State; now, therefore, be it |
|
RESOLVED, That the House of Representatives of the 84th Texas |
|
Legislature hereby honor Carlos Aguayo for his participation in the |
|
Rio Grande Valley Legislative Internship Program and extend to him |
|
sincere best wishes for the future; and, be it further |
|
RESOLVED, That an official copy of this resolution be |
|
prepared for Mr. Aguayo as an expression of high regard by the Texas |
|
House of Representatives. |
